The is a dual retriggerable Monostable Multivibrator with a reset. It is pin compatible with low-power Schottky TTL LSTTL. It comes with an output pulse width control. The Schmitt-trigger action in the nA and nB inputs, makes the circuit highly tolerant to slower input rise and fall times. The output pulse is controlled by three methods, first - The basic pulse is programmed by selection of an external resistor REXT and capacitor CEXT. Second, once triggered, the basic output pulse width may be extended by retriggering the gated active low-going edge input nA\\ or the active high-going edge input nB. By repeating this process, the output pulse period nQ = high, nQ\ = low can be made as long as desired. Alternatively an output delay can be terminated at any time by a low-going edge on input nRD\, which also inhibits the triggering. Third, an internal connection from nRD to the input gates makes it possible to trigger.
